BALA CYNWYD, Pa., Feb. 25,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Larimar Therapeutics, Inc. (“Larimar”) (Nasdaq: LRMR), a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ing treatments for complex rare diseases, today announced the pricing of its upsized underwritten public offering of 20,000,000 shares of its common stock at a price to the public of $5.00 per share. The aggregate gross proceeds to Larimar from this offering are expected to be $100 million, before deducting underwriting discounts and commissions and other offering expenses. In addition, Larimar has granted the underwriters a 30-day option to purchase up to an additional 3,000,000 shares of its common stock at the public offering price, less underwriting discounts and commissions. All shares of common stock are being offered by Larimar. The offering is expected to close on or about February 27, 2026, subject to the satisfaction of customary closing conditions.

J.P. Morgan and Guggenheim Securities are acting as joint bookrunning managers for the offering. LifeSci Capital and William Blair are acting as bookrunners for the offering. Citizens Capital Markets is acting as lead manager for the offering, and Jones is acting as co-manager for the offering.

Larimar intends to use the net proceeds from the offering to support the development of nomlabofusp and for working capital and general corporate purposes, including research and development expenses and commercialization expenses.

The offering is being made pursuant to a shelf registration statement on Form S-3 (File No. 333-279275) that was declared effective by the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”) on May 24, 2024. About Larimar Therapeutics, Inc.

Larimar Therapeutics, Inc. (Nasdaq: LRMR), is a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ing treatments for complex rare diseases. Larimar’s lead compound, nomlabofusp, is being developed as a potential treatment for Friedreich’s ataxia. Larimar also plans to use its intracellular delivery platform to design other fusion proteins to target additional rare diseases characterized by deficiencies in intracellular bioactive compounds.
